1、查詢伺服器連接多少資料庫
static int callback(void *NotUsed, int argc, char **argv, char **azColName)
{
NotUsed = 0;
int i;
for (i = 0; i < argc; i++)
{
printf("%s = %s\n", azColName[i], argv[i] ? argv[i] : "NULL");
}
printf("\n");
return 0;
}
int main(int argc, char **argv)
{
sqlite3 *db;
char *zErrMsg = 0;
int rc;
rc = sqlite3_open("test.db3", &db);
if (rc == SQLITE_OK)
{
rc = sqlite3_exec(db,
"CREATE TABLE test (id INTEGER NOT NULL, text VARCHAR(100))"
, callback, 0, &zErrMsg);
if (rc != SQLITE_OK) fprintf(stderr, "SQL error: %s\n", zErrMsg);
rc = sqlite3_exec(db,
"INSERT INTO test VALUES (1, 'text1')"
, callback, 0, &zErrMsg);
if (rc != SQLITE_OK) fprintf(stderr, "SQL error: %s\n", zErrMsg);
rc = sqlite3_exec(db,
"SELECT * FROM test"
, callback, 0, &zErrMsg);
if (rc != SQLITE_OK) fprintf(stderr, "SQL error: %s\n", zErrMsg);
sqlite3_close(db);
} else {
fprintf(stderr, "Can't open database: %s\n", sqlite3_errmsg(db));
sqlite3_close(db);
return 1;
}
return 0;
}
2、如何查看連接本機的連接ip數量
查看連接本機的連接ip數量的方法步驟如下:
第一、同時按住開始圖標鍵和R鍵。
第二、然後輸入cmd。
第三、按Enter鍵會出現下圖然後輸入netstat -a -n
第四、然後就會出現本地連接的所有ip地址。
3、區域網怎麼查看共享伺服器連接數
參考下面鏈接
http://jingyan.baidu.com/article/ceb9fb10c0d6af8cad2ba037.html
4、Linux命令如何查看伺服器中資料庫連接數有多少個
netstat -pant |grep 1521|wc -l
5、怎麼查看windows伺服器上所有IP當前的連接數和一天的連接統計數
貌似安裝一個網路防火牆,在防火牆log中記錄所有通訊,然後再導入excel,排序統計下。
另外,很好奇:windows上多個IP是一個段的么
6、如何查看WIN2003網站伺服器當前連接數~和埠連接數
最簡單的辦法是裝個360安全衛士.選擇"高級"->"網路鏈接狀態"就可以看到你想要的信息了.而且可以清除木馬.我的伺服器就一直開了360安全衛士.我覺得蠻好的
7、如何查看linux並發連接數?
|1、查看Web伺服器(Nginx Apache)的並發請求數及其TCP連接狀態:
netstat -n | awk '/^tcp/ {++S[$NF]} END {for(a in S) print a, S[a]}'
netstat -n|grep ^tcp|awk '{print $NF}'|sort -nr|uniq -c
或者:
netstat -n | awk '/^tcp/ {++state[$NF]} END {for(key in state) print key,"t",state[key]}'
返回結果一般如下:
LAST_ACK 5 (正在等待處理的請求數)
SYN_RECV 30
ESTABLISHED 1597 (正常數據傳輸狀態)
FIN_WAIT1 51
FIN_WAIT2 504
TIME_WAIT 1057 (處理完畢,等待超時結束的請求數)
其他參數說明:
CLOSED:無連接是活動的或正在進行
LISTEN:伺服器在等待進入呼叫
SYN_RECV:一個連接請求已經到達,等待確認
SYN_SENT:應用已經開始,打開一個連接
ESTABLISHED:正常數據傳輸狀態
FIN_WAIT1:應用說它已經完成
FIN_WAIT2:另一邊已同意釋放
ITMED_WAIT:等待所有分組死掉
CLOSING:兩邊同時嘗試關閉
TIME_WAIT:另一邊已初始化一個釋放
LAST_ACK:等待所有分組死掉
2、查看Nginx運行進程數
ps -ef | grep nginx | wc -l
返回的數字就是nginx的運行進程數,如果是apache則執行
ps -ef | grep httpd | wc -l
3、查看Web伺服器進程連接數:
netstat -antp | grep 80 | grep ESTABLISHED -c
8、如何查看連接到伺服器的所有IP
用網路連接查看IP與DNS地址:
先從「開始」菜單中打開「控制面板」程序,進入控制面板窗口後,找到「網路連接」這一項,打開。也可以從桌面「網路鄰居」右鍵,選擇「屬性」,打開「網路連接」。
進入網路連接窗口後,選擇「本地連接」這個圖標,右鍵,選擇菜單中的屬性這一項。
進入本地連接屬性窗口後,選擇「此連接使用下列項目」下的「Internet 協議(TCP/IP)」這一項,然後按右下側的「屬性」
進入下一個窗口後,就能看到IP地址以及DNS伺服器地址了,上面是IP地址,下面是DNS伺服器地址。
提示:只有區域網,設置了IP地址與DNS伺服器地址,才能看到,否則一般是自動獲取。保存備份方法就只能用手寫方式,把IP地址與DNS伺服器地址給記錄下來了。
9、如何查看linux並發連接數
^^1、查看Web伺服器(Nginx Apache)的並發請求數及其TCP連接狀態:
netstat -n | awk '/^tcp/ {++S[$NF]} END {for(a in S) print a, S[a]}'
netstat -n|grep ^tcp|awk '{print $NF}'|sort -nr|uniq -c
或者:
netstat -n | awk '/^tcp/ {++state[$NF]} END {for(key in state) print key,"t",state[key]}'
返回結果一般如下:
LAST_ACK 5 (正在等待處理的請求數)
SYN_RECV 30
ESTABLISHED 1597 (正常數據傳輸狀態)
FIN_WAIT1 51
FIN_WAIT2 504
TIME_WAIT 1057 (處理完畢,等待超時結束的請求數)
其他參數說明:
CLOSED:無連接是活動的或正在進行
LISTEN:伺服器在等待進入呼叫
SYN_RECV:一個連接請求已經到達,等待確認
SYN_SENT:應用已經開始,打開一個連接
ESTABLISHED:正常數據傳輸狀態
FIN_WAIT1:應用說它已經完成
FIN_WAIT2:另一邊已同意釋放
ITMED_WAIT:等待所有分組死掉
CLOSING:兩邊同時嘗試關閉
TIME_WAIT:另一邊已初始化一個釋放
LAST_ACK:等待所有分組死掉
2、查看Nginx運行進程數
ps -ef | grep nginx | wc -l
返回的數字就是nginx的運行進程數,如果是apache則執行
ps -ef | grep httpd | wc -l
3、查看Web伺服器進程連接數:
netstat -antp | grep 80 | grep ESTABLISHED -c